# From Prompts to Policies: How RL Builds Better AI Agents with Mahesh Sathiamoorthy - #731 Page: https://stenobird.com/podcast/twiml-ai-podcast/from-prompts-to-policies-how-rl-builds-better-ai-agents-with-mahesh-sathiamoorthy-731 Text version: https://stenobird.com/podcast/twiml-ai-podcast/from-prompts-to-policies-how-rl-builds-better-ai-agents-with-mahesh-sathiamoorthy-731.md Podcast: [The TWIML AI Podcast (formerly This Week in Machine Learning & Artificial Intelligence)](https://stenobird.com/podcast/twiml-ai-podcast) Published: 2025-05-13T22:10:00+00:00 Episode link: https://twimlai.com/podcast/twimlai/from-prompts-to-policies-how-rl-builds-better-ai-agents/ Audio file: https://pscrb.fm/rss/p/traffic.megaphone.fm/MLN2707985480.mp3?updated=1747175429 Processing state: failed JSON: https://stenobird.com/v1/public/podcasts/twiml-ai-podcast/episodes/from-prompts-to-policies-how-rl-builds-better-ai-agents-with-mahesh-sathiamoorthy-731 Duration seconds: 3685 ## Resource Today, we're joined by Mahesh Sathiamoorthy, co-founder and CEO of Bespoke Labs, to discuss how reinforcement learning (RL) is reshaping the way we build custom agents on top of foundation models. Mahesh highlights the crucial role of data curation, evaluation, and error analysis in model performance, and explains why RL offers a more robust alternative to prompting, and how it can improve multi-step tool use capabilities. We also explore the limitations of supervised fine-tuning (SFT) for tool-augmented reasoning tasks, the reward-shaping strategies they’ve used, and Bespoke Labs’ open-source libraries like Curator. We also touch on the models MiniCheck for hallucination detection and MiniChart for chart-based QA. The complete show notes for this episode can be found at https://twimlai.com/go/731. ## Actions - request_transcript: `POST https://stenobird.com/v1/public/podcasts/twiml-ai-podcast/episodes/from-prompts-to-policies-how-rl-builds-better-ai-agents-with-mahesh-sathiamoorthy-731/transcription-requests` — Idempotently request low-priority transcript generation for this episode. - read_markdown: `GET https://stenobird.com/podcast/twiml-ai-podcast/from-prompts-to-policies-how-rl-builds-better-ai-agents-with-mahesh-sathiamoorthy-731.md` — Read the agent-friendly Markdown representation of this episode resource. A page view does not enqueue transcription. Agents should invoke `request_transcript` explicitly when they need this episode processed. ## Transcript Full transcripts are not published on public pages unless there is a clear rights basis.